This petition was created for the purpose of changing Northern Michigan University's parking for residential students. As an Northern Michigan University students who pay $140 for a residential parking pass, we expect parking to be within a reasonable distance from our current place of residence. Through the construction of new dormitories and deconstruction of old dormitories we have been shorted reasonable parking availability.

The construction of the new dormitories known as "The Woods" has created a student housing availability difference of plus one hundred students per building. However no increase of residential parking has been created to match the new housing availability.
Directly outside of the side entrance of the new dormitories The Woods in lots 46 and 26 there are roughly 163 parking spots(hand counted assume error of 10 or less). This is 41% parking availability to the students living in The Woods. Leaving 59% of students living in dormitories "The Woods" looking for parking elsewhere. Which due to overcrowded parking in other residential parking lots leaves many students who live in The Woods as well as other dormitories walking a half a mile or more to the entrance of their dormitories in the dark and soon to be several feet of snow. This is an unacceptable distance to walk when paying the premium rate of $140 for a parking pass.

We, the undersigned, call on Northern Michigan University to take one of three actions.
1. Create more residential parking availability.
2. Allow parking parking in non-residential lots after designated times.
3. Reduce the cost of residential parking permits.
